Nilu Karun is an artist and photographer who lives and works in Cambridge, UK. She has been commissioned projects by different companies and worked together with several institutions on a freelance basis.

She has a special passion for the exploration of the human form and movement, to capture human shapes and reveal the sensual nature of motion. 

Her other work includes portrait, family and architectural photography as well as photojournalism.

 

Nilu is fascinated by 19th century photographic printing methods and currently conducting a research and experiments with these forgotten techniques to produce unusual images with a nostalgic breath to it.

She takes inspiration from vintage photographs, books or magazines. Some of her influences include Henri Cartier-Bresson, Helmut Newton, Richard Avedon, Ruth Bernhard & Bill Brandt.

Her work has been on display by exhibitions in Cambridge. 

Earlier this year she has won first place in the Cambridge Explorer Magazine’s Photography competition.
